[QUOTE="APX78, post: 6588603, member: 95371"]I bought what I thought were two genuine Morgan Silver Dollars from a seller on Ebay. Well they arrived today. They don't look normal and they failed many tests of genuine dollars, especially obvious is the weight of these coins. I have attached photos of the supposed 1895 S Dollar. The Grams are way under at 22.6 and the grains are also way under at 348. I have contacted Ebay and I was told to return them for a full refund. But I'm concerned about others. This seller has sold a number of these dollars and he currently has 13 active Morgan Dollar listings with bids on them. The seller has told me that he bought these online from a website called wewinns,(I went on the site and they sell fakes), yet he has not shut down his active listings with more of these coins.
